 The verse you shared is from Surah Al-An'am (6:92). Here’s an explanation of its meaning and interpretation:


Translation:


"And this is a Book which We have revealed, blessed and confirming what came before it, so that you may warn the Mother of Cities (Makkah) and those around it. Those who believe in the Hereafter believe in it, and they are mindful of their prayers."


Tafsir (Explanation):


1. A Blessed Book:

The Quran is described as a "blessed" book because it is a source of divine guidance, mercy, and goodness. Its teachings are eternal and lead to success in both this world and the Hereafter.



2. Confirming Previous Scriptures:

The Quran validates the messages of earlier revealed books, such as the Torah, Psalms, and Gospel, confirming the truth they contained. It corrects distortions and provides the final, complete message from Allah.



3. Warning to Makkah and Surrounding Areas:

The "Mother of Cities" refers to Makkah, the central and most significant city in Arabia. The Quran was revealed to warn the people of Makkah and the surrounding regions about the consequences of rejecting Allah's guidance and to call them to righteousness.



4. Belief in the Hereafter:

A key characteristic of true believers is their firm faith in the Hereafter. This belief motivates them to follow the Quran’s teachings sincerely and strive for eternal success.



5. Guarding Their Prayers:

The Quran highlights the importance of establishing and safeguarding prayers. This implies praying on time, with devotion and sincerity, as an essential act of worship and a sign of faith.




Summary:


This verse emphasizes the Quran's divine nature, its purpose as a confirmation of previous revelations, and its role as a guide for humanity. It highlights the qualities of true believers: their belief in the Hereafter and their commitment to prayer. The verse also stresses the importance of Makkah as the starting point of this universal message.
